Bart Officials Offers Explanation For Ongoing Escalator Issues Abc7 There are two distinct groups of fall incidents – those that occur on the escalator and those that result in a passenger falling over the handrail of an escalator. researchers have attributed the causes of falls on escalators to contact with another passenger, inappropriate footwear, balance and coordination issues in the elderly, among others. Escalator malfunction. if an escalator suddenly changes direction or speed, it is likely the result of an escalator malfunction. this malfunction might be the result of several different issues. first, it might be a result of a defective part. alternatively, the problem may be that a part has worn out or become broken over time. Skirt brushes. these are located along the skirt panels of the escalator, which are the vertical surfaces on either side of the steps. they help prevent objects from being caught in the gap between the skirt and the step, which could cause damage or injury. skirt brushes also alert the users to keep their feet away from the edge of the step. Stand in the center part of the step. never drag or slide your feet along the edge. always face forward and hold the handrail. reposition your hand slowly if the handrail moves faster or slower than the steps. always hold children’s hands on escalators and do not permit children to sit or play on the steps. do not sit on the handrail. Here are some steps you can take to prevent escalator injuries: make sure shoes are tied before getting on an escalator. stand in the center of the step and be sure to step off of the escalator at the end of your ride. always hold children's hands on escalators and do not permit children to sit or play on the steps.
